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 1 pound ground beef

  • 1 cup uncooked long-grain white rice

  • 2 cups beef broth (or water with bouillon)

  • 1 small onion, finely chopped

  • 2 cloves garlic, minced

  • 1 teaspoon paprika

  • ½ teaspoon black pepper

  • Salt to taste

  • 1 cup milk or cream

  • 2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il or butter

Optional additions: peas, corn, mushrooms, or bell peppers for extra texture and color.
